Pilot Knob is an unincorporated community in southern Travis County, Texas, United States, named after an extinct volcano found in the area. The area is semi-rural with residences on large lots or acreage and convenience stores and other small businesses. Pilot Knob is situated 1½ miles southwest of Texas Army National Guard.
